Isle of Man Post Office says you can start sending mail to Israel again - but no Gaza, Iran or the West Bank.
Deliveries and collections to all the countries had been suspended during the current Middle East conflict.
However, the post office says Royal Mail has announced it's restarted services to Israel.
It's still unable to accept items addressed to Gaza or Khan Yunis and The West Bank, and services to Iran remain suspended.
